Line L passes through the points (1, 1) and (7, 8). What is the slope of a line that is perpendicular to line L?
asambeis [7]

When a line passes through the two points (x_{1},y_{1}) and (x_{2},y_{2}) , its slope is given by the formula m= \frac{y_{2}-y_{1}}{x_{2}-x_{1}}

In this question, a line L passes through the points (1,1) and (7,8)

So, its slope is given by m=\frac{8-1}{7-1}

m=\frac{7}{6}

When two lines are perpendicular, then the product of their slopes is -1.

Since, the slope of the line L is \frac{7}{6} , so the slope of the line which is perpendicular to the given line L is \frac{-6}{7} as the product of \frac{-6}{7} \times \frac{7}{6}=-1.

The length of a rectangular garden is 6 feet longer than its width. The garden's perimeter is 180 feet. Find the length of the g
slavikrds [6]
Perimeter is all sides added up together. So as you don't know a side's length you can put it as x and make an equation.
x + x + x + 6 + x + 6 = 180
4x +12 = 180
4x = 180 - 12
4x = 168
x = 168/4
x = 42
as length is 6 feet longer than width length is equal to 42 + 6 = 48 feet
